Portfolio Rebalancing Techniques for 2026

In 2026's volatile markets, systematic rebalancing is essential for maintaining target allocations and realizing gains:

5

Threshold-Based Rebalancing

Low Risk

Rebalance portfolio only when asset allocations deviate from targets by predefined percentage thresholds, minimizing transaction costs while maintaining discipline.

Automated threshold monitoring
Tax-aware rebalancing
Transaction cost optimization
Multi-portfolio synchronization

🎯 Optimal 2026 Rebalancing Parameters:

Thresholds: 5% for core holdings, 10% for satellite positions | Frequency: Monthly review, quarterly execution | Tools: Portfolio rebalancing bots with tax-loss harvesting

2026 Portfolio Risk Management Framework

⚠️ Essential Risk Controls:

  • Position Limits: No single asset > 15% of portfolio
  • Sector Limits: No single sector > 30% of portfolio
  • Drawdown Limits: Automatic de-risking if portfolio down 25%
  • Liquidity Requirements: Minimum 5-10% in stablecoins/cash
  • Correlation Monitoring: Monthly correlation analysis

Minimum effective diversification requires: Basic: $5,000+ (5-7 assets) | Recommended: $25,000+ (10-15 assets) | Professional: $100,000+ (15-25 assets with sector allocation). Below $5,000, focus on 3-5 quality assets rather than over-diversification.

Optimal numbers: Conservative: 5-8 assets | Balanced: 10-15 assets | Aggressive: 15-25 assets. Quality matters more than quantity—better to hold 10 well-researched assets than 30 random ones. Most diversification benefits plateau at 15-20 uncorrelated assets.

2026 allocation ranges: Conservative: 40-60% | Balanced: 20-40% | Growth: 10-30% | Aggressive: 5-20%. Bitcoin's correlation with the broader market has decreased to 0.65, making lower allocations more viable for diversified portfolios seeking alpha.

Rebalancing frequency: Threshold-based: When any asset deviates ±5-10% from target | Time-based: Quarterly for most investors, monthly for active traders. Tax considerations: Rebalance in tax-advantaged accounts first to minimize capital gains.

#1 Mistake: False diversification—holding many assets that are highly correlated. Example: 10 different DeFi tokens that all move together. True diversification requires assets with low correlation across different sectors, market caps, and use cases.

Allocation by risk tolerance: Conservative: 5-10% crypto | Moderate: 10-20% crypto | Aggressive: 20-30% crypto. Within crypto allocation, further diversify across Bitcoin, large caps, and growth sectors. Rebalance entire portfolio (crypto + traditional) annually.
